Unhappy Guilty or Not Guilty?

A couple of days ago in the metro Atlanta area a 2 year old child died (heat related) as the result of being left in a car with the windows up for over 9 hours in the parking lot of her place of employment. The grandmother, who was also the child's caretaker, says that she forgot to take the child to daycare. She has not been charged, as of yet, with any crime.

Do you feel that she should be charged with the crime or do you believe that you can leave a child in a car all day and not remember your daily routine of taking the child to day care?

I'll have to watch the news to see if they give her age and any medical problems that she may have had that caused memory problems, because I am definitely not feeling her reasoning.
